Dialysis (dia-lysis): the separation of smaller molecules from larger molecules in a solution by the selective … Cytolysis, or osmotic lysis, occurs when a cell bursts due to an osmotic imbalance that has caused excess water to diffuse into the cell. Water can enter the cell by diffusion through the cell membrane or through selective membrane channels called aquaporins, which greatly facilitate the flow of water. WebApoptosis is an orderly process in which the cell’s contents break down and are packaged into small packets of membrane for “garbage collection” by immune cells. It contrasts with necrosis (death by injury), in which the dying cell’s contents spill out and cause inflammation. Apoptosis removes cells during development.
